Beautiful recreational areas surround Lake Texoma. State Parks and National Parks, Campgrounds, Marinas, Hiking Trails, Biking Trails, and National Wildlife refuges.
Lake Texoma is a Corp of Engineers lake, which means the shoreline is owned and managed by the Federal Government. The shoreline is protected as a natural habitat providing home to a wide variety of wildlife. Along the path of migrating birds, it is a bird watcher and photographer paradise.
